Red Bull: The Mercedes topic is over for us
Red Bull is seemingly shaping up to be powered by Ferrari engines in 2016 and beyond, despite recent reports linking the energy drinks outfit to Mercedes power units. Earlier, it emerged that the energy drink team and its sister outfit Toro Rosso were definitely set to split with their current engine partner Renault. Reportedly, Red Bull's preferred new supplier was Mercedes, but it is believed the Daimler board has finally decided against working with the former quadruple world champions. 'The Mercedes topic is over for us,' Red Bull official Helmut Marko confirmed to Bild newspaper. 'We are focusing on other options now.'
